Forecast: Sold Production of Bottles of Colourless Glass for Beverages and Foodstuffs in the UK

In 2023, the sold production of bottles of colourless glass for beverages and foodstuffs in the UK stood at a specific benchmark not detailed here. The forecasted data from 2024 to 2028 suggests a steady growth trend. Starting at 713.05 million euros in 2024, production is expected to increase each year, reaching 771.75 million euros by 2028. This represents a consistent upward trajectory in the industry. Year-on-year increases average around 2% to 2.5% during this period, highlighting moderate growth driven by demand stability and potential market expansion.
